210 Changed cql2pqf transformation to use a different evaluation order. The
211 new order is: always, relation, structure, position, truncation, index
212 and relationModifier. Old order was: always, relation, relationModifier,
213 structure, index, position, truncation. Note that the the latter ones
214 override former ones for identical attributes.. The new scheme means that
215 it is possible to override any existing attribute with a relationModifier.
216 And also that it is possible to override everything for the index rule
217 (except the ones listed in relationModifier). No order is perfect but this
218 one, we believe, covers more real cases.. The "always" should have been
219 called "default", since the attributes there can be overridden with all

423 Increase TCP/IP listener backlog from 3 (which I am guessing was
424 copied from the SunOS manual entry way back when) so SOMAXCONN, so
425 that the socket will queue as many incoming connections as it's able
426 to handle ongoing connections. In other words, it will never now
427 refuse a connection that it would be able to handle merely because
428 it's not got around to accepting() enough of the pending connections
429 yet. This is the behaviour anyway under Linux, where the listen()
430 argument is ignored; but not under BSD and on systems such as
431 MS-Windows that use BSD-derived TCP/IP stacks. The behaviour of
432 YAZ-based servers should now be uniform across operating systems in

1546 * YAZ now auto-generates decoders/encoders for the Z39.50 protocol using
1547 a fairly small ASN.1 compiler written in Tcl. The compiler is located
1548 in util/yc.tcl. The auto-generated C code structures are, in a few
1549 cases, incompatible with the old decoders. There are differences in the
1550 following C structures Z_DiagRec, Z_External, Z_SortRequest, Z_SortResponse,
1551 Z_AttributesPlusTerm, Z_ProximityOperator, Z_DefaultDiagFormat.
1552 The preprocessor variable ASN_COMPILED is defined when the compiled
1553 ASN.1 is being used. Encoder/decoder routines as well as the Z39.50
1554 protocol ASN.1 is located sub directory <tt>z39.50</tt>. If you
1555 wish to use the old encoders/decoders you can specify --disable-yc
